NoAmp-Low-Rider-DI
Audio plugin based on the SansAmp Bass Driver DI using circuit analysis instead of captures.

cmake
View Details ▼
cmake
Cross-platform build automation system, that generates recipes for native build systems.
cmake {{path/to/project_directory}}
Generate a build recipe in the current directory with `CMakeLists.txt` from a project directory:
cmake --build {{path/to/build_directory}}
Use a generated recipe in a given directory to build artifacts:
cmake --install {{path/to/build_directory}} --strip
Install the build artifacts into `/usr/local/` and strip debugging symbols:
ctest
View Details ▼
ctest
CMake test driver program.
ctest
Run all tests in the current CMake build directory:
ctest {{[-j|--parallel]}} 4
Run all tests defined in the CMake build directory, executing 4 [j]obs at a time in parallel:
ctest {{[-j|--parallel]}}
Run all tests on all processor cores:
git submodule
View Details ▼
git submodule
Inspect, update, and manage submodules.
git submodule
View existing submodules and the checked-out commit for each one:
git submodule update --init --recursive
Install a repository's submodules (listed in `.gitmodules`):
git submodule add {{repository_url}}
Add a Git repository as a submodule of the current one:
